Our Newest Opportunity: 

The HR Operations Specialist is responsible for supporting comprehensive day-to-day operations across the People
and Culture organization at OneDigital. This role serves as a critical connection between Talent Acquisition, Talent
Management, Benefits, DEIB, Learning and Development, Internal Communications, Compensation, HRIS, and general
HR administration. The specialist ensures the efficient execution of employee lifecycle activities, enhances
organizational effectiveness, and actively collaborates with departments on various projects to maintain
departmental efficiency.
Essential Duties and Responsibilities (includes but is not limited to):
Human Resources Operations:
  • Respond to HR email inbox, calls, Workday Help cases, and direct inquiries promptly; resolve
  • employee concerns or escalate as necessary.
  • Facilitate onboarding processes, including creating job profiles and positions in Workday, managing
  • background checks and job assessments, extending formal offer letters, and overseeing new hire
  • onboarding in Workday.
  • Conduct new hire orientations, culture presentations, and maintain onboarding documentation.
  • Conduct stay and exit interviews, as well as new hire satisfaction interviews, to ensure a positive
  • onboarding and employment experience.
  • Manage employee offboarding processes, including voluntary resignations, terminations, and related
  • documentation.
  • Prepare and update employment records, ensuring accurate documentation and compliance.
  • Respond to state Department of Labor (DOL) correspondence and unemployment claim inquiries; set
  • up state accounts as required.
  • Prepare required federal and state employment reports (IRS, DOL, insurance commissioners, etc.).
  • Administer Workday system data entry and tracking.
  • ·Support performance management and talent review activities.
  • Facilitate internal promotions and appointment-letter processes.
  • Participate in additional training activities such as Learning & Development (L&D) sessions, Learning
Management Systems (LMS), and Artificial Intelligence (AI) tools to enhance departmental efficiency
and employee experience.
  • Collaborate to create and execute communication and change management plans.
  • Collaboration and Partnerships:
  • Actively collaborate and partner with various teams within the People and Culture organization,
  • including:
  • Talent Acquisition to streamline onboarding processes.
  • Benefits team to ensure smooth enrollment and administration of employee benefits.
  • DEIB team to integrate diversity, equity, inclusion, and belonging practices into HR processes.
  • Learning and Development to align training initiatives with HR and talent management objectives.
  • Internal Communications to effectively disseminate HR-related information throughout the organization.
  • Compensation to ensure consistency and accuracy in compensation-related data and practices.
  • HRIS to optimize Workday and other HR system functionalities for improved efficiency and data integrity.
Qualifications, Skills and Requirements:
  • Proven knowledge of HR principles and best practices.
  • Strong communication skills (written and verbal) and interpersonal skills.
  • Demonstrated ability to manage multiple tasks effectively in a fast-paced environment.
  • Exceptional attention to detail and organizational capabilities.
  • Strong analytical, problem-solving, and adaptability skills.
  • Ability to maintain confidentiality and handle sensitive information.
  • Proactive mindset and comfortable initiating continuous improvements.
  • Advanced computer proficiency, particularly in Microsoft Office Suite and Workday.
Education, Training and Experience:
  • Bachelor’s degree in Human Resources or related field preferred.
  • Minimum 3 years’ experience in an HR Coordinator, Specialist, or related HR role required.
  • Human Resource certification preferred but not required.
